You and your US Native English Tutor meet in the online class through Internet telephone connection in Skype. You will improve your spoken English by way of conversation with your English tutor. Below is the process of how an online English tutoring class is conducted:
1. Your English tutor calls you at the scheduled time for your class. Your English tutor greets you and introduces the topic for the session. This topic is a conversation with a dialog for two persons to role play (see English conversation lessons), vocabulary and grammar.
2. In the online class, you and your English tutor role play using the conversation lesson dialog, exchange questions and answers. Your tutor corrects you, have you repeat after him or her, and provides feedback on your progress. See US Native English Tutoring Guidelines for more information.
3. At the end of the lesson, your English tutor summarizes key points of the lesson and asks you if you have any question or comment before the class ends.
4. Your English tutor and you decide on the topic for the next lesson. You may make a request for a conversation from the English conversation lessons.
5. You and your English tutor greet each other and exit.
We find that English learners are highly interested in our conversational approach. Our findings show conversational tutoring benefits students in the following ways:
increases student motivation to speak English.
helps the English tutor give immediate feedback to the student to see his or her improvement.
provides a meaningful context with a topic of interest to the student, to motivate the student to learn new concepts.
provides opportunities for the student to use both formal and informal English.
